Why Choose a Treadmill for Your Home Gym?
1. Convenience
Having a treadmill at home eliminates travel time to the gym, permitting workouts that fit seamlessly into busy schedules. No more worrying about gym hours or harsh weather condition-- your treadmill is constantly readily available.
2. Versatility
Treadmills offer various workout alternatives, from steady-state running to high-intensity period training (HIIT). Users can change speed, slope, and workout programs to suit their fitness levels and preferences.
3. Consistent Routine
With a treadmill in your home, creating and keeping a consistent exercise routine becomes simpler. The temptation to skip workouts due to unfavorable conditions decreases considerably when you have your devices at home.
4. Cost-Effectiveness
Although the preliminary financial investment might appear significant, owning a treadmill can save cash in the long run, getting rid of gym membership charges and travel costs.
Types of Home Gym Treadmills
When selecting a treadmill for your home gym, it's essential to comprehend the various types readily available. Here is a breakdown of the most typical types:
| Treadmill Type | Features | Ideal For |
|---|---|---|
| Manual Treadmills | Self-powered, no electrical power required, normally lighter and portable | Novices, budget-conscious |
| Electric Treadmills | Motor-powered, several speed and slope settings, typically function programs | General fitness enthusiasts |
| Collapsible Treadmills | Space-saving design, can be easily kept away when not in usage | Smaller sized living areas |
| Business Treadmills | Sturdy, created for frequent use, typically more expensive | Major athletes, home fitness centers |
Secret Features to Consider
When choosing a treadmill, think about the following features:
| Feature | Value |
|---|---|
| Max Speed | Figures out workout strength; greater max speeds are suitable for runners |
| Slope Options | Enables diverse exercises and simulates outside terrain |
| Display Console | Crucial for tracking progress (speed, time, calories burned) |
| Shock Absorption | Important for reducing influence on joints during running |
| Weight Capacity | Should accommodate the user's weight; check for a margin over your weight |

Tips for Setting Up Your Home Gym Treadmill
Location: Choose an area that permits adequate ventilation and access to power outlets. Also think about sound levels if you have close neighbors.
Matting: Use a treadmill mat to secure your flooring and lower vibration noise.
Lighting: Ensure the location is well-lit to develop an encouraging environment for workouts.
Availability: Keep your treadmill in a location where it's easy to gain access to and usage frequently.
Storage: If space is a concern, think about collapsible models or those that provide easy storage solutions.
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)
1. Just how much area do I require for a treadmill?
Usually, you need at least 6-8 feet of length and 3-4 feet of width for a safe and reliable exercise space. Collapsible models can assist in saving area.
2. How often should I utilize my treadmill?
For ideal health advantages, go for a minimum of 150 minutes of moderate aerobic activity each week. This can be broken down into shorter sessions as needed.
3. What upkeep do treadmills require?
Routine maintenance consists of cleaning up the belt and deck, lubricating the belt, and looking for loose parts. Consult your user manual for particular maintenance standards.
4. Can I do HIIT on a treadmill?
Yes, lots of treadmills are created for high-intensity workouts. Look for models with quick speed and incline changes for the best experience.
